I Love My Home at the Landings

I have lived at The Landings for seven years now and overall, I love living here.

My apartment (two bedrooms) has lots of storage -- plenty of cabinets in the kitchen and a pantry, as well as outside storage and two walk-in closets. The balcony is the largest I have ever had, with lots of room for plants and a swing, and I use it often. The rooms are spacious compared to many other apartments I've seen in this area. This is what you get with an older apartment, and I am very satisfied.

I enjoy walking my dog here -- we have 40 acres. It feels like living in a park, with the pond, the many trees and flowers, the large green spaces and the wildlife. Yes, the geese poop (and maybe if you aren't familiar with it you might think it's dog poop), but lots of us love them and enjoy feeding them and watching them raise their young in the spring.

I have read the other reviews and have experienced some of the same problems, but with an older apartment, there will be repairs. The office and maintenance staff have always been courteous, friendly and helpful, and I never had a problem getting anything attended to. Perhaps it's all in the way you ask, stay on top of things and be reasonable in your expectations.

Also, whenever I have asked permission to make improvements on my own, such as paint or to add anything else within reason, I have been given permission to do so. The staff has even offered to do it for me, but sometimes I like to do things myself.

They are always making improvements, such as upgrading the apartments (beautiful), painted all the exteriors, removed dead trees and planted new ones, put in nice shrubs and plants. The laundry rooms have recently received all new appliances, and parking is now being enforced. So, if everyone follows the rules there won't be problems. You won't get towed if you display your sticker, and if your friends park in a visitor's space or on the street, they will be safe as well. If people don't abuse the new laundry facilities, they will stay in nice shape. And if you want to have a big party, there is a party room you can rent and there are areas outside to entertain where there are barbeque grills.

While there have been issues in the past with noisy neighbors, these were young people, probably away from home for the first time; they like their fun and their music loud. However, these neighbors are no longer here, and my current neighbors are nice. Everyone makes a little noise now and again, it is an apartment after all, not completely soundproof, but I have no complaints.

I do wish the police would make more regular rounds here, as they have in the past. I believe their presence may discourage crime in the area, but while I have heard about crime, I have not experienced any problems. I feel safe and at home.

The grounds do get messy sometimes (mostly holidays), but this is much better than in the past. I think the blame lies with the tenants, not maintenance. If people would place their trash in the dumpster, this would not be a problem. We have a nice place here if people would only do their part and raise their children to do the same. Maintenance can only do so much, the rest is up to us.

When I first moved in, it appeared there were more Hispanic tenants than anyone else, but now I see more diversification. So long as people act decently, though, I couldn't care less. A little variety doesn't hurt.

I have always recommended this complex to other people whenever I get the chance. It's a nice place to live if you carefully select an apartment that feels like home to you, and the rent is reasonable. They don't offer a lot of "amenities" to jack up the rent and I wouldn't use anyway. We do have two beautiful pools, a volley ball court, a basketball court and an exercise room that people use all the time.

So, I hope if you're looking for an apartment home, you check this place out in person before making your final decision. I'm really glad I did.
